What are Dendritic Cells?

A

A bridge between the innate and adaptive immune systems

  • Able to collect huge amounts of material from the environment and digest it
  • They then present this information on their surface and show it to T cells

What are the 2 types of T cells?

A

1) CD4+ helper T cells
* Release cytokines which attract and activate other immune cells

2) CD8+ cytotoxic T cells
* Release cytokines and substances like granzymes which kill infected cells

How are T cell responses generated?

A
  1. Dendritic cells swallow antigens by phagocytosis
  2. DCs move to T cell zones
  3. T cells interact with specific DCs and bind tightly
  4. The specific T cell proliferates and develops
  5. Activated T cells move into the inflamed tissues

How are B cells activated?

A
  1. Interact with T cells
  2. Activated B cells move and proliferate
  3. Mature into plasma cells
  4. Produce millions of antibodies
